تحويل ملفات EML إلى JPG باستخدام Python

تخزن ملفات البريد الإلكتروني بامتداد .eml جميع بيانات الرسالة بالكامل، بما في ذلك تفاصيل المرسل، الموضوع، نص الجسم، والمرفقات، بطريقة منظمة. تُستخدم على نطاق واسع في أنظمة الأرشفة، منصات الامتثال، والطب الشرعي الرقمي لحفظ سجلات التواصل. تحويل ملفات EML إلى صيغ صور مثل JPG يوفر طريقة فعّالة لتصوير رسائل البريد كلقطات ثابتة يمكن مشاركتها بسهولة، تضمينها، أو عرضها في التقارير. يشرح هذا الدليل كيفية تحويل EML إلى JPG باستخدام Python، مستفيدًا من GroupDocs.Viewer لإنتاج صور عالية الجودة من محتوى البريد الإلكتروني. من خلال فهم كيفية تحويل EML إلى JPG في Python، يمكن للمطورين تبسيط عملية إنشاء أرشيفات بصرية، وثائق امتثال، أو تقارير جاهزة للتدقيق.

خطوات تحويل EML إلى JPG باستخدام Python

  1. قم بتثبيت GroupDocs.Viewer لـ Python عبر .NET باستخدام pip لتمكين تحويل EML
  2. استورد وحدات groupdocs.viewer و groupdocs.viewer.options للوصول إلى ميزات تصدير JPG
  3. استخدم فئة Viewer داخل كتلة with لتحميل ملف EML وإدارة الموارد تلقائيًا
  4. أنشئ JpgViewOptions وحدد اسم ملف الإخراج لصورة JPG
  5. حدد العرض والارتفاع المطلوبين للتحكم في دقة الصورة الناتجة
  6. استدعِ viewer.view(viewOptions) لتحويل محتوى EML إلى تنسيق JPG

تضمن هذه الطريقة تحويل كل رسالة بريد إلكتروني بدقة إلى ملف صورة ثابت مع الحفاظ على تنسيقها الأصلي، الخطوط، والبنية البصرية العامة. يوفر كود Python لتحويل EML إلى JPG تنفيذًا نظيفًا وقابلًا للتكيف يتيح للمطورين التحكم في معلمات الإخراج المختلفة، مثل الدقة، تخطيط الصفحات، وخيارات التحجيم. كما يدعم الأتمتة، مما يجعله مثاليًا للتحويلات الجماعية أو التكامل في خطوط معالجة البريد الحالية. سواء كنت تسعى لإنشاء أرشيف بصري قابل للبحث، أو توليد معاينات مصغرة مدمجة لمنصات الويب، أو إدراج لقطات بريد منسقة جيدًا في تقارير شاملة، فإن هذه الطريقة توفر حلاً موثوقًا وفعّالًا ينتج نتائج ذات جودة احترافية بأقل جهد إعداد.

كود تحويل EML إلى JPG باستخدام Python

يوفر الكود أعلاه نهجًا فعالًا للمطورين، المحللين، ومديري المحتوى الذين يحتاجون إلى تمثيل بصري سريع لبيانات البريد دون الاعتماد على تطبيقات بريد مخصصة. تتيح القدرة على تصدير EML كصورة JPG باستخدام Python بأبعاد قابلة للتعديل أن تكون هذه الطريقة مفيدة بشكل خاص لتقارير الامتثال، الوثائق البصرية، وتدفقات النشر. بالإضافة إلى ذلك، يضمن أن الصور البريدية تحافظ على التناسق عبر مختلف المنصات ويمكن دمجها بسلاسة في المحتوى الثابت. هذا يُختتم البرنامج التعليمي حول تحويل ملفات EML إلى JPG باستخدام Python—حلًا قابلاً للتكيف جاهزًا للتكامل في مشروع الأرشفة أو توليد الصور التالي الخاص بك.

للتقنيات ذات الصلة، استكشف دليلنا حول تحويل EML إلى PNG باستخدام Python، الذي يشرح كيفية تحويل ملفات البريد إلى صيغة PNG عالية الدقة للتصوير الشفاف والجودة الخالية من الفقد.

 عربي